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Sprint 43 #4972

Closed
19 of 40 tasks
Fatman13 opened this issue Jun 27, 2022 · 0 comments
Closed
19 of 40 tasks

Sprint 43 #4972

Fatman13 opened this issue Jun 27, 2022 · 0 comments
Labels
C-dev-productivity Category: Developer productivity Epic

Comments

@Fatman13
Copy link
Contributor

Fatman13 commented Jun 27, 2022

背景

sprint日期:6/27 - 7/08
代码审阅:文档
文档建立:文档

上个sprint

目标

  • venus-cluster 完成 v0.4.0 10个 issue
    • 降低使用门槛
    • 提供自定义入口
    • 开始少量开源的算法定制
  • 确认主要代码库的配置合理,包括 actions (上个sprint通用部分)
  • 确定对于已经稳定的代码库,新提交 issue 关于测试用例的最低要求 (上个sprint中测试用例部分;util,fix)
  • 确定venus各组件nv16升级的代码,调整文档,发布v1.6.0 (还缺少文档调整)
  • venus-market 完成10个 issue (完成4个)
  • venus-market 检索支持;RootCID检索支持;
  • venus v1.17.0 分支pr引入;venus-miner issues(详见下面)(待讨论:看看lotus有没有进master)
  • 监控metrics调研;公共组件?
  • github project管理规范 (待review)
  • 团队熟悉fvm项目,提交2个PR

项目规范化

Venus 组件有相对一致的CI/CD:

  • pr流程,如删除原分支,至少有一个approved,所有检查项通过,保护分支不能直接提交commits等;
  • 按照发版规范设定保护分支;
  • pr检查项是否完备,如 gofmt, 单元测试, 覆盖率显示等;
  • 提交 issue, pr 模板是否统一;
  • dependabot alerts 统一;

venus

v1.7.0 分支

v1.6.*分支

venus-miner

v1.7.0 分支

v1.6.*分支

  • 主网版本

venus-market

Bug:

优化项:

piece store:

@Fatman13 Fatman13 added Epic C-dev-productivity Category: Developer productivity labels Jun 27, 2022
@Fatman13 Fatman13 moved this to In Progress in Venus Project Jul 4, 2022
@Fatman13 Fatman13 closed this as completed Jul 8, 2022
Repository owner moved this from In Progress to Done in Venus Project Jul 8, 2022
@Fatman13 Fatman13 mentioned this issue Jul 8, 2022
27 tasks
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
C-dev-productivity Category: Developer productivity Epic
Projects
Archived in project
Development

No branches or pull requests

1 participant